[QUOTE="Dragoon300, post: 2480843, member: 115285"] From my observations 14000 shot start initiation pressure is a bit high for any copper jacketed projectile. Solid copper projectiles may possibly be up there when close to the lands. I am planning on working up some 338 LM loads with 255 & 265 grain Badlands ICBM2's this Summer and will see. I do use the shot start initiation pressure and weighting factor settings in QuickLOAD to adjust things to my velocity and pressure signs. Make sure you measure your case volume and adjust that as well. [/QUOTE]
